Package co.ecg.alpaca.toolkit.generated
Class GroupPaging.GroupGroupPagingGetAvailableTargetListRequest
java.lang.Object
co.ecg.alpaca.toolkit.messaging.request.Request<GroupPaging.GroupGroupPagingGetAvailableTargetListResponse>
co.ecg.alpaca.toolkit.generated.GroupPaging.GroupGroupPagingGetAvailableTargetListRequest
- Enclosing class:
- GroupPaging
public static class GroupPaging.GroupGroupPagingGetAvailableTargetListRequest
extends Request<GroupPaging.GroupGroupPagingGetAvailableTargetListResponse>
Get a list of users that can be assigned as targets to a given paging group. Searching for users by group only makes sense when the paging group is part of an Enterprise. The response is either GroupGroupPagingGetAvailableTargetListResponse or ErrorResponse.
- Author:
- AlpacaGenerator
-
Nested Class Summary
Nested classes/interfaces inherited from class co.ecg.alpaca.toolkit.messaging.request.Request
Request.Protocol
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ected Integer
protected @Valid SearchCriteriaDn[]
protected @Valid SearchCriteriaExactUserDepartment
protected @Valid SearchCriteriaExactUserGroup
protected @Valid SearchCriteriaExtension[]
protected @Valid SearchCriteriaUserFirstName[]
protected @Valid SearchCriteriaUserId[]
protected @Valid SearchCriteriaUserLastName[]
protected @NotNull @Valid GroupPaging
-
Constructor Summary
ConstructorsConstructorDescription -
Method Summary
Modifier and TypeMethodDescriptionvoid
Forms the XML Document for this Request Object.getEmptyObject
(BroadWorksServer broadWorksServer) Retrieves this object with minimal setup.setResponseSizeLimit
(Integer responseSizeLimit) setSearchCriteriaDn
(SearchCriteriaDn... searchCriteriaDn) setSearchCriteriaExactUserDepartment
(SearchCriteriaExactUserDepartment searchCriteriaExactUserDepartment) setSearchCriteriaExactUserGroup
(SearchCriteriaExactUserGroup searchCriteriaExactUserGroup) setSearchCriteriaExtension
(SearchCriteriaExtension... searchCriteriaExtension) setSearchCriteriaUserFirstName
(SearchCriteriaUserFirstName... searchCriteriaUserFirstName) setSearchCriteriaUserId
(SearchCriteriaUserId... searchCriteriaUserId) setSearchCriteriaUserLastName
(SearchCriteriaUserLastName... searchCriteriaUserLastName) setUser
(GroupPaging user) Methods inherited from class co.ecg.alpaca.toolkit.messaging.request.Request
appendChild, appendChild, appendChild, asyncFire, createElement, createNilElement, createNilElement, createTextElement, equals, fire, fire, getBroadWorksServer, getCacheString, getCommandElement, getCommandType, getDomDocument, getId, getOCSProtocol, getRequestTimeoutMillis, getResponseClass, getRetries, getRetryCodes, getRootElement, getValidationErrorsAsString, hashCode, isIgnoreCache, isMemberOfBundle, isValid, setBroadWorksServer, setCommandElement, setCommandType, setDomDocument, setEcho, setIgnoreCache, setMemberOfBundle, setRequestId, setRequestTimeoutMillis, setResponseClass, setRetries, setRetryCodes, setRootElement, toString, validate
-
Field Details
-
user
-
responseSizeLimit
-
searchCriteriaUserLastName
-
searchCriteriaUserFirstName
-
searchCriteriaExactUserDepartment
-
searchCriteriaExactUserGroup
-
searchCriteriaUserId
-
searchCriteriaDn
-
searchCriteriaExtension
-
-
Constructor Details
-
GroupGroupPagingGetAvailableTargetListRequest
public GroupGroupPagingGetAvailableTargetListRequest() -
GroupGroupPagingGetAvailableTargetListRequest
-
-
Method Details
-
setUser
-
getGroupPaging
-
setResponseSizeLimit
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setResponseSizeLimit(Integer responseSizeLimit) -
getResponseSizeLimit
-
setSearchCriteriaUserLastName
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aUserLastName(SearchCriteriaUserLastName... searchCriteriaUserLastName) -
getSearchCriteriaUserLastName
-
setSearchCriteriaUserFirstName
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aUserFirstName(SearchCriteriaUserFirstName... searchCriteriaUserFirstName) -
getSearchCriteriaUserFirstName
-
setSearchCriteriaExactUserDepartment
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aExactUserDepartment(SearchCriteriaExactUserDepartment searchCriteriaExactUserDepartment) -
getSearchCriteriaExactUserDepartment
-
setSearchCriteriaExactUserGroup
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aExactUserGroup(SearchCriteriaExactUserGroup searchCriteriaExactUserGroup) -
getSearchCriteriaExactUserGroup
-
setSearchCriteriaUserId
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aUserId(SearchCriteriaUserId... searchCriteriaUserId) -
getSearchCriteriaUserId
-
setSearchCriteriaDn
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aDn(SearchCriteriaDn... searchCriteriaDn) -
getSearchCriteriaDn
-
setSearchCriteriaExtension
public GroupPaging.GroupGroupPagingGetAvailableTargetListRequest setSearchCriteriaExtension(SearchCriteriaExtension... searchCriteriaExtension) -
getSearchCriteriaExtension
-
getEmptyObject
public static GroupPaging.GroupGroupPagingGetAvailableTargetListRequest getEmptyObject(BroadWorksServer broadWorksServer) Retrieves this object with minimal setup.- Parameters:
broadWorksServer
- The BroadWorksServer
-
formRequest
public void formRequest()Forms the XML Document for this Request Object. Called by the Request upon fire().- Overrides:
formRequest
in classRequest<GroupPaging.GroupGroupPagingGetAvailableTargetListResponse>
-